
JAMESTOWN, NY (WNY News Now) – In an effort to help our furry friends find their fur-ever homes, WNY News Now has teamed up with the Chautauqua County Humane Society in a segment we like to call Pet Of The Week.
This week, we meet little miss Gollum, a two and a half month old kitty with a big heart.
Gollum was just altered, and despite being a little sleepy she is doing well according to director of fundraising and communications Brian Papalia.
In addition to being spayed recently, she is all up to date on vaccinations, microchipped, and ready to meet her family.
Gollum is a friendly girl who would prefer a playmate, though it’s not necessary.
